Re: I just got my copy of Muchi Muchi Pork/pink sweets, and.
Absolutely no reason to waste the fact that you got the version with the DLC code. Sure, it bumps the price, but it's also virtually impossible to play through any other means unless you either a) have the Cave Shooting Collection DLC or b) mod your xbox. Or c) buy the actual Matsuri version of the arcade board, but GOOD LUCK WITH THAT.
My opinion? Keeping a game sealed for display is silly beyond the realm of reason. Games exist to be played.

Save and load options save and load your options. No really, I'm not taking the piss. That's actually what they do.
There's a bunch of settings you can play around with on a per game basis, changing between game versions and difficulties. I recommend that you stick to default settings BUT change the version to 1.00 on the games because the 1.01 versions are considerably easier.
